Complete Buyer's Guide: How to Choose Stocking Stuffers Kids Will Actually Love

1. Think Beyond 'Small and Cheap'

The biggest mistake is treating the stocking as a dumping ground for dollar store trinkets. The best stuffers have purpose and play value. Ask yourself: Will this disappear into the toy box tomorrow, or will it be used? Aim for items that are activities (like the Melissa & Doug craft kits), tools for imagination (like the walkie talkies), or upgrades to daily essentials (like the no-mess crayons).

2. Prioritize Open-Ended Play Over One-Trick Ponies

Toys with a single function get old fast. Look for stuffers that grow with the child’s imagination. The transformable fidget spinners can be a quiet fidget tool, a construction set, or a spinning top. The digital pet hamster ball combines care, collection, and mini-games. These multi-use items provide lasting engagement, stretching the value of that small gift all year long.

3. Match the Stuffer to the Child's Developmental Stage

Ages 1-3: Focus on sensory exploration and cause-and-effect. The B. toys keys are perfect with their lights, sounds, and chunky buttons. Avoid small parts.

Ages 4-7: This is the golden age for creative expression and pretend play. Craft kits, dress-up accessories, and simple interactive toys like the BITZEE ball are huge hits.

Ages 8+: Engage their logic, skill-building, and social interests. Puzzle games like the GiiKER Super Decoder, more complex building sets, or gear for their hobbies (specialty art supplies, sports accessories) work brilliantly.

4. The 'Fits in a Stocking' Litmus Test

It seems obvious, but it’s worth a rule: if you have to jam, fold, or force it, it’s not a stocking stuffer-it’s a wrapped gift. Ideal dimensions are roughly under 7 inches in any direction and relatively flat or slim. The items on this list are all champions of the ‘stocking silhouette.’ Remember, part of the fun is the surprise of pulling out multiple, distinct treasures.

5. Balance Immediate Gratification with Lasting Value

A good stocking has a mix. Include one or two items of pure, instant joy (a cool tech toy, a favorite candy). Then, round it out with items that have staying power-the puzzle they’ll master over weeks, the art supplies they’ll use for months, the craft that becomes a decoration. This balance makes the stocking feel both exciting in the moment and thoughtfully curated for the long haul.

6. Don't Underestimate the Power of 'Grown-Up' Tools

Kids love feeling capable and trusted. ‘Real’ tools made for them are often the biggest hits. The kid-friendly walkie talkies, a small but functional flashlight, a magnifying glass, or a mini screwdriver set for tinkering all convey, ‘You’re big enough for this.’ This category builds confidence and often sparks the deepest, most focused play.

Frequently Asked Questions

1. What are the best stocking stuffers for toddlers who still put things in their mouths?

Safety is absolutely paramount. For this age group, stick to established brands known for rigorous safety testing like B. toys, Melissa & Doug, and Fat Brain Toys. Look for items made from solid, durable plastics or wood with no small, detachable parts. The B. toys FunKeys are a great example-they’re chunky, have no parts that can be bitten off, and are made from baby-safe materials. Always double-check the manufacturer’s recommended age, which is a guideline for safety, not just skill level.

2. How many stocking stuffers should I get per child?

There’s no magic number, but a good rule of thumb is 5-7 substantial items plus some traditional filler like fruit, nuts, or chocolate coins. The key is variety: include a mix of something to do (a craft or puzzle), something to play with (a small toy), something useful (cool socks, fun toothbrush), and something to consume (candy, snack). This creates a rewarding, layered unwrapping experience without going overboard on cost or clutter.

3. Are fidget toys still good gifts, or are they just a passing trend?

While the peak ‘fad’ phase has passed, the core need for sensory and fidget tools is very real and here to stay. The key is choosing a quality, multi-functional fidget toy. Avoid the basic, noisy spinners from 2017. Instead, look for options like the transformable spinners or the magnetic building fidgets that also challenge creativity and problem-solving. These serve the same calming, focus-aiding purpose but have much deeper play value.

4. What's a good stocking stuffer for a kid who 'has everything'?

For the hard-to-shop-for child, skip more ‘stuff’ and gift an ‘experience’ or a skill-building challenge. A complex logic puzzle like the GiiKER Super Decoder offers hundreds of hours of mental engagement. A sophisticated craft kit (like high-quality origami or bracelet weaving) teaches a new skill. Or, consider a ‘ticket’ for a future experience rolled up in the stocking-like a coupon for a special one-on-one trip to the movies, a hiking adventure, or a baking session with you.
